Introduced by Bill Mitchell, head Cadillac and LaSalle designer, the Sixty Special quickly became one of the most influential styles to come out of Detroit. Most notably, the new design sat three inches lower than past models, eliminating the use of running boards. Originally designated to be a LaSalle sport sedan, it was deemed too expensive and instead received the Cadillac badge. A complete success, this new model replaced the Series 70 as the most expensive owner-driven Cadillac of its day. Still, the Sixty Special outsold every Cadillac line with a newly designed Fleetwood body, higher quality trim and a wood grain dash. The fender skirts and full hubcaps on each wheel added the final touch. This stunning 1941 Cadillac Series Sixty Special Sedan benefitted from a body-on restoration, including paint and interior, in 2013. The new paint is a dark green metallic, similar to its original color. When examined for restoration, there were no filler in the body and certainly no rust on the chassis. The beautiful dark green, glove-soft leather interior and matching carpeting are - of course - impeccable. At the same time, the engine was rebuilt and a 700 R4 automatic transmission was added. To enhance trouble-free and comfortable touring, after-market air conditioning, front disc brakes, and four new Diamondback whitewall radial tires were also installed. The 6-volt electrical system was upgraded to 12-volt with a new alternator. The radio was converted to AM/FM, but the original face was kept with new electrics. An electric fuel pump and a battery cutoff switch have been added, in addition to an electronic ignition. All four original door panels were left intact as they were (and still are) in very nice condition. All the instruments and glass are clear, the glass has no chips, and all the lights and gauges work. The radiator has a new core and an auxiliary temperature gauge was added under the dash. Also added was an electric cooling fan, but it's rarely used as the car runs cool. Since the restoration, this lovely classic has logged approximately 14,000 miles. It has been on several Classic Car Club caravans and is accepted as a Full Classic by the CCCA. This car runs perfectly and has never failed the owner. It's often used for local events and runs well at 70 mph on the highway. The new owner will have the perfect tour car with the benefit of more comfort than it had when original.
